Former India captain Sourav Ganguly has praised Bengal pacer Akash Deep following his inclusion in the squad for the upcoming first Test against Bangladesh.

Sourav Ganguly highlighted that Akash Deep can bowl at high speeds like Mohammed Siraj and Mohammed Shami.

Akash Deep took a five-wicket haul for India A in the second innings of the 2024 Duleep Trophy match against India B.

Notably, Akash also secured four wickets in the first innings at the M.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ru. He retained his place in the Test squad following his performance.

Akash Deep Is An Outstanding Young Fast Bowler - Sourav Ganguly

Speaking at an event in Kolkata, Sourav Ganguly said that Akash Deep is an outstanding young fast bowler, adding that he is someone to watch out for. Ganguly stated that Akash can bowl at high 140s (kph) like Mohammed Siraj and Mohammed Shami.

"Akash Deep is an outstanding young fast bowler. He runs in, bowls quick, and will bowl for long periods,” Ganguly said, as quoted by PTI.

"He is fit, I've seen him play for Bengal over a long period of time, taking wickets. He will be as quick as Mohammed Siraj and Mohammed Shami, hitting high 140s. He is one to watch out for," he added.

Akash Deep made his Test debut against England in February this year. The right-arm fast bowler dismissed Zak Crawley, Ben Duckett, and Ollie Pope in the fourth Test match in Ranchi.

He wasn't included in the fifth and final Test of the series, where the Rohit Sharma-led team secured a 4-1 win.

The 27-year-old pacer has played 32 first-class matches. He has taken 116 wickets at an average of 22.86, including five five-wicket hauls and one ten-wicket match.

I Don't See Bangladesh Winning - Sourav Ganguly

Sourav Ganguly acknowledged that Bangladesh beat Pakistan in their recent Test series.

The 52-year-old stated that Bangladesh cannot defeat India despite their confidence from the recent victory. Ganguly added that Bangladesh will give tough competition to India.

"Going to Pakistan and beating them is never easy, so congratulations to the (Bangladesh) players. But India will be a different kettle of fish; India, whether at home or away, are a fantastic side with a very strong batting unit,” Ganguly further added.

"I don't see Bangladesh winning; India will win the series. But India must expect good and tough cricket from Bangladesh because they are coming into the series with a lot of confidence after beating Pakistan in Pakistan,” he commented.

The BCCI has also included Yash Dayal in the squad for the first Test against Bangladesh alongside Jasprit Bumrah, Siraj, and Akash Deep.

Dayal earned his maiden call-up after recent performances. Ravichandran Ashwin, Ravindra Jadeja, Axar Patel, and Kuldeep Yadav will handle spin duties.

The first Test match between India and Bangladesh will be played at the M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ai, starting on September 19.
